Facilities ticket — Halewick Tower, night shift.

Issue: support team reporting east stairwell reader rejecting badges after midnight. Reader was reset this morning; firmware updated. Overnight crew should now badge as normal. If the reader fails again, use the manual keypad by the fire door — do not prop the door. Log any further failures with the time and badge name. Temporary keypad code for the fallback door is below.

door code, tajeg-fawip: bdg-K-62

## Changelog — 3.9.2 (key rotation)

Heads up, support crew: following the stale-cache bug postmortem (the one where Lorn Analytics dashboards showed week-old numbers), we rotated the cache-invalidation signing key and shortened TTLs across Brightmere. If customers mention lingering stale data after today, ask them to hard-refresh once — anything beyond that, escalate to platform. Patched builds must be verified against the new key, which is appended below for reference.

rollout seal: bky4_x7Gc

Subject: Quickstore 4.2 — bloom filter now fronts the KV layer

Plugin authors: starting with this release, Quickstore places a bloom filter ahead of the key-value store. Negative lookups return faster; false positives fall through safely. No API changes are required on your side. Verify your plugin against the staging build referenced below.

session token of fahif-tadup = htk3_9c7

## Idempotency Keys for Payment Retries (Lumopay)

Every retry of a charge request must reuse the original idempotency key; generating a new key on retry can produce duplicate charges. Keys are scoped per merchant and expire after 48 hours. Reviewers should verify keys are derived server-side, never from client input. The full key-generation specification and threat model are maintained on the internal page.

dashboard of kaguf-tawip = https://vault.merlaqsys.test/issue